Just wanted to say hello, i'm not really a newbie to fountain pens, to this board however i am. Currently i have a Faber-Castell F nib fountain pen, but i also have a MB Starwalker (fineliner), and MB Meisterstuck Mozart (roller ball). I'm just starting to build up a respectable pen collection. Being a male there are limited "accessories" we can have and this is one that i think shows personality and character.

I love the idea of fountain pens, all started when i was in junior high many years ago when we made our own paper and had to do calligraphy. Since then i've been hooked, but due to the cost of the pens i only ended up getting a good one now. I had a cheap parker from grand and toy for many years but it always leaked into the cap and i spent more time cleaning it than using it.

But i'm excited to get back into it, i took a 4 year break from keeping a daily journal but i'd like to restart that.

Anyway so far this is a great site and i look forward to learning more!
